Gauss's Law relates the electric flux through a closed surface to the charge enclosed by that surface, providing a powerful tool for calculating electric fields in symmetric situations. It is one of Maxwell's equations, which are the foundation of classical electromagnetism, and is particularly useful for systems with high symmetry such as spheres, cylinders, and planes.
